Biography
Architect since 2006, Yves Ubelmann began his career working in the Middle East and Central Asia, where he carried out surveys of archeological sites using photogrammetry. In 2013, he founded the ICONEM start-up whose mission is to digitize endangered heritage sites around the world to ensure their transmission to future generations.

Keynote 30 - The intelligence of digital twins: AI to help protect cultural heritage
Tuesday 22 September, 18:40 – 19:00Main StageSince it was founded in 2013, Iconem has leveraged the latest innovations to document heritage sites under threat, from conflict zones to UNESCO World Heritage sites, turning raw data from the field into precise 3D models at a scale and speed no other process could match. This talk retraces that journey: how cultural heritage digitization and AI became inseparable from the start, and how the company's ongoing R&D pushes further, enriching these models into spatialized knowledge systems and intimate, immersive experiences for all. Alongside the technical path, expect a visual journey through some of the most striking digital twins produced to date, and a look at what AI still has to offer a field where what is lost cannot be recaptured.
